We are currently reviewing security vulnerabilities identified by our container security scanning solution in Microsoft-provided container images running within our Azure Kubernetes Service (AKS) environments.
The findings relate primarily to images hosted under mcr.microsoft.com that appear to be associated with AKS system components, Kubernetes CSI drivers, Azure networking components, Azure Monitor / Container Insights, Microsoft Defender for Containers, CoreDNS, Metrics Server, and other Microsoft-managed or Microsoft-supported AKS components.
Our production AKS environment is currently running Kubernetes version 1.34.4 and is healthy and operational. However, the vulnerability scanner continues to report multiple Critical and High severity vulnerabilities in Microsoft-provided system images.
Similar findings are also present across our other AKS environments.

Guidance Requested from Microsoft
We would appreciate clarification from the Microsoft AKS technical team on the following:
- Microsoft ownership Can Microsoft confirm which of the above images are Microsoft-managed AKS/system components or Microsoft-managed AKS add-ons?
- Supported remediation For Critical and High vulnerabilities in these Microsoft-managed images, what is the supported remediation procedure?
- Upgrade mechanism Should these vulnerabilities be remediated through:
- AKS Kubernetes version upgrade
- AKS patch version upgrade
- AKS node image upgrade
- Managed AKS add-on update
- CSI driver update
- Azure CNI/networking component update
- Azure Monitor / Container Insights update
- Microsoft Defender for Containers update
- or another Microsoft-managed update mechanism?
- Manual image replacement Are customers expected to manually replace or override any of these container images? Our understanding is that manually changing Microsoft-managed AKS system images may not be supported, so we would like Microsoft to confirm the correct remediation approach.
- Vulnerability applicability For the reported Critical and High vulnerabilities, could Microsoft confirm whether they are:
- applicable and exploitable in AKS,
- non-exploitable in the current AKS configuration,
- known false-positive scanner findings,
- already mitigated by the AKS platform,
- or currently awaiting an updated Microsoft image?
- Patched versions Where remediation is available, could Microsoft identify the relevant:
- AKS version,
- component/add-on version,
- node image version,
- or container image version
that contains the security fix?
